About Spring Lake Villas Neighborhood

Spring Lake Villas is a non-gated neighborhood of approximately 129 single-family homes nestled along the northern shoreline of Spring Lake in Dr. Phillips, accessible via Wallace Road and Spring Song Drive in the 32819 zip code. Developed primarily between 1985 and 1988, this is one of the established communities of the Dr. Phillips area — a neighborhood with character, mature oak canopy, and a sense of permanence that newer communities are still working to earn.

Homes in Spring Lake Villas reflect the architectural sensibility of mid-to-late 1980s Florida residential construction, with Contemporary, Traditional, and Florida-style designs built in brick, stucco, and wood frame with shingle roofs. Typical homes feature 2–3 bedrooms, 2–3 bathrooms, and 2-car garages, with floor plans ranging from approximately 1,200 to 2,500 square feet. Many residences have been thoughtfully updated over the years — vaulted ceilings with skylights, open floor plans, tile and wood flooring, and upgraded kitchens are common features in renovated homes throughout the neighborhood.

The neighborhood's defining physical attributes are its Spring Lake frontage along the northern shore, its perimeter sidewalk network for pedestrian enjoyment, and the community tennis court that anchors an active, neighborly culture. Mature landscapes of towering oak trees, ponds, and greenspace lend the community a lush, shaded feel that distinguishes it from newer construction nearby. Some properties offer private pools, water views, or direct access to the tree and greenspace areas that give the neighborhood its Florida character.

What makes Spring Lake Villas genuinely unusual — even by Dr. Phillips standards — is its location. Universal Studios Florida and Universal's Volcano Bay Waterpark sit within walking distance, just east along Wallace Road. Yet the neighborhood itself maintains the unhurried atmosphere of a residential community insulated from the commercial energy surrounding the parks. It is a quiet, tree-lined neighborhood in one of the most theme-park-adjacent residential locations in all of Florida.

Spring Lake Villas Location & Connections

Spring Lake Villas is located in the heart of Dr. Phillips, positioned off Wallace Road and Spring Song Drive along the northern shore of Spring Lake. The neighborhood's location places it at a remarkable intersection of residential calm and metropolitan accessibility — sitting between the parkland and lake environment to the west and the Universal Studios theme park campus immediately to the east along Wallace Road.

Wallace Road serves as the primary access corridor, connecting residents northward to Conroy Road and Interstate 4, and southward toward Turkey Lake Road and Sand Lake Road. Interstate 4 and Florida's Turnpike are both efficiently accessible, enabling straightforward commutes throughout Central Florida. The neighborhood sits approximately 11 miles from Downtown Orlando and 5 miles from Walt Disney World — practical distances by Central Florida standards that make this location genuinely useful as a primary residence.

🎓 Schools

Spring Lake Villas is served by Orange County Public Schools:

  • Elementary: Dr. Phillips Elementary School (approximately 1 mile west on Wallace Road)
  • Middle: Southwest Middle School
  • High: Dr. Phillips High School (approximately 2.5 miles)

Dr. Phillips High School offers two magnet programs — the Center for International Studies and Visual & Performing Arts — making it one of the stronger comprehensive high school options in Orange County. Private school options including The First Academy and Discovery Academy are accessible from this location.

Spring Lake Villas HOA & CDD Information

Spring Lake Villas has a mandatory Homeowners Association that maintains the community's shared areas, enforces deed restrictions, and protects the neighborhood character that makes Spring Lake Villas an enduring choice in the Dr. Phillips market. The HOA structure reflects the neighborhood's established, non-gated character — focused on common area upkeep and standards rather than resort-level amenities, which keeps fees more modest relative to gated communities in the area.

Spring Lake Villas does not have a Community Development District (CDD) fee, which is a notable cost advantage for buyers comparing it to some newer Dr. Phillips and Southwest Orlando communities where CDD assessments can add meaningful annual carrying costs. Residents of Spring Lake Villas pay HOA fees only, without an additional CDD layer.

Can you actually walk to Universal Studios from Spring Lake Villas?
Yes — Spring Lake Villas is among the very few residential neighborhoods in Florida where residents can walk or bike to a major theme park. Universal Studios Florida's main entrance is approximately 0.5 miles east along Wallace Road. Universal's Volcano Bay Waterpark is similarly accessible. Many residents take advantage of Universal annual passes as an everyday lifestyle amenity rather than an occasional excursion. This proximity is one of the most distinctive attributes of this location within the Dr. Phillips area.
